Data Warehouse is not only for strategic or analytics
Data Warehouse as a term has been often used as an integral component of high-end decision support and back-room analytics. The fact is that Data warehouses can be a universal source for any information requirement.
Data Warehouse is a repository of data, whereby the application of that data is ‘limited only’ by the detail and the way data is stored. Query and analysis, business modeling , data mining are the buzzword use of data warehouses. However, there are more fundamental and bigger usage possible for Data Warehouse. For example enterprise reporting , which can provide you capability to report on Summary level as well as transaction level data, one can drive operational management benefits. You not only can use data warehouse to find the sales trends, but also to generate the list of all 5000 sales officers, along with the list of every sales order which they have booked in last six months.
It all depends on the granularity of the data which is stored in the data warehouse.
Essentially, Data Warehouse is a repository of data, which can be used for unlimited number of applications, as long as you have right tools sitting on top of it, and detailed enough information sitting inside it.
